火山云代理商:如何在火山引擎上实现高并发的网站架构设计?
一、高并发架构设计的核心挑战
高并发场景下,网站需应对瞬时流量激增、资源动态扩展、数据一致性及响应延迟等问题。传统架构往往面临单点故障、资源浪费和运维复杂度高的痛点。
二、火山引擎的核心优势分析
火山引擎作为字节跳动旗下的云服务平台,具备以下优势:
- 全球化的基础设施:覆盖多地域的边缘节点,支持低延迟访问;
- 弹性计算能力:支持秒级扩容的云服务器(ecs)与容器服务(VKE);
- 智能化调度:基于AI的负载均衡(CLB)和自动扩缩容策略;
- 数据服务生态:提供高可用的分布式数据库(如Redis、MySQL)及大数据分析工具;
- 成本优化能力:按需付费模式与闲置资源回收机制。
三、基于火山引擎的高并发架构设计方案
1. 分层架构与负载均衡
采用前端接入层→业务逻辑层→数据存储层的分层设计:
- 使用火山引擎CLB(Cloud Load Balancer)实现流量分发,支持HTTP/HTTPS及TCP协议;
- 通过加权轮询或最小连接数算法,将请求均衡分发至后端服务器集群。
2. 弹性计算与自动扩缩容
通过火山引擎弹性伸缩组(Auto Scaling Group)实现动态资源管理:
- 预设cpu利用率、网络流量等阈值触发扩容;
- 结合容器服务(VKE)快速部署无状态服务,提升资源利用率。
3. 高性能数据库与缓存优化
火山引擎提供多类型数据服务支持高并发场景:
- 使用分布式数据库(如TDSQL)实现读写分离与分库分表;
- 通过缓存服务(Redis)缓存热点数据,降低数据库负载;
- 结合消息队列(Kafka)实现异步处理与削峰填谷。
4. 内容分发与边缘加速
利用火山引擎cdn与边缘计算能力:
- 静态资源(图片、JS/CSS)通过CDN加速,减少回源请求;
- 动态内容通过边缘节点就近处理,降低端到端延迟。
5. 监控与容灾保障
火山引擎提供全链路监控与容灾方案:

- 使用云监控(Cloud Monitor)实时追踪应用性能指标(QPS、错误率等);
- 通过多可用区部署与跨地域备份,保障服务高可用性;
- 结合日志服务(Log Service)快速定位故障根因。
四、实践案例与成本效益
某电商平台采用火山引擎架构后:
- 峰值QPS从5万提升至50万,响应时间下降60%;
- 通过弹性扩缩容减少30%的服务器成本;
- CDN流量费用节省25%以上。
总结
在火山引擎上构建高并发网站架构,需充分利用其弹性计算、智能调度与全球化基础设施优势。通过分层设计、动态扩缩容、缓存优化及边缘加速等策略,可显著提升系统吞吐能力与稳定性。同时,火山引擎的按需付费模式与全链路监控工具,为企业提供了兼顾性能与成本的高效解决方案。

kf@jusoucn.com
4008-020-360


4008-020-360
